SCIENTIFIC NAME - Pseudocheilinus octotaenia

COMMON NAME – Eightline Wrasse

SIZE – 5.5 in (14 cm)

MIN. AQUARIUM SIZE - 30 gal (113 L)

FOODS AND FEEDING - Should be fed a variety of high quality marine meaty foods. Will also eat other crustaceans.

REEF COMPATIBILITY – With caution, may eat ornamental shrimp.

CAPTIVE CARE –These fish do better with other aggressive fish. They can be kept with other wrasses, but not ones of the same genus or similarly shaped or colored. The can be used to keep pest pyramid snails under control. Wrasses are known jumpers so the aquarium top should be covered.
